LAHORE – A soldier of Pakistan Army, who was stationed in Saudi Arabia wasmartyred while performing his professional duties on Friday.
Muhammad Ishaq, the Hawaldar of Pakistan army – who hailed from theneighbouring village of Kot Islam, Ghagh – was dispatched on a specialmission to the Holy Kingdom some two months back.
The army personnel breathed his last after a grenade exploded and his bodywould be transported to Pakistan on Monday.
According to leading daily Nawa-i-Waqt, army officials had informedvictim’s family of the martyrdom of Ishaq.
Meanwhile, Chief of Army Staff General Qamar Javed Bajwa and Prime MinisterShahid Khaqan Abbasi would be leaving for a single day tour to Saudi Arabion Saturday to inspect the military drills of 41-nation Islamic MilitaryCounter Terrorism Coalition (IMCTC).
